Samsung Galaxy Tab S9 Series Receives January 2026 Security Update

Samsung has initiated the rollout of its latest security patch for its flagship tablet lineup. The January 2026 security update is now available for the Galaxy Tab S9, Galaxy Tab S9+, and Galaxy Tab S9 Ultra, marking the first devices to receive this patch.

Update Details and Availability

The update is currently live in Samsung's home market of South Korea. It carries a firmware version of X81xNKOS5DZA1 and has a download size of approximately 428MB. Users can manually check for the update by navigating to Settings > Software update > Download and install on their devices.

This security patch addresses a total of 55 vulnerabilities that were present in the previous version of the operating system. The comprehensive fix enhances the overall security posture of the devices, protecting user data and system integrity from potential exploits.

Future Software Roadmap

Beyond this security update, the Galaxy Tab S9 series remains on a promising software trajectory. The tablets are confirmed to be eligible for the upcoming One UI 8.5 update, which is based on Android 16 QPR2. This major update is expected to introduce a refreshed user interface alongside a suite of new features and enhancements, ensuring the devices stay current with the latest software innovations from Samsung.

The global rollout of the January 2026 security patch is anticipated to expand to other regions in the coming days, following the initial deployment in South Korea.
